Frequently asked questions about Los Medanos, Pittsburg

Is now a good time to buy in Los Medanos, Pittsburg?

Data for Los Medanos, Pittsburg specifically is limited. Only 3 sales in the most recent month is not enough to read neighborhood-level conditions, and one unusual transaction can dominate the reported numbers. Zooming out to the broader Pittsburg market: pittsburg is balanced but competition is picking up. It remains a reasonable environment for buyers, though acting decisively on well-priced homes is becoming more important.

How do Los Medanos, Pittsburg home prices compare to Pittsburg and the Bay Area?

Los Medanos, Pittsburg's 3 recent sales were at a median of $510K. That is roughly 16% below Pittsburg's city-wide median of $610K. With only a small sample, it is hard to draw firm neighborhood-level conclusions. This could reflect a specific property or an unusual transaction rather than a broader trend. For context, the Bay Area median is $1.85M.

What will my total monthly cost be on a typical Los Medanos, Pittsburg home?

Using the 3 recent sales (median $510K) as a rough anchor, your estimated total monthly cost with 20% down at 6.49% would be approximately $3,291:

  • $2,576 principal and interest
  • $531 property tax (California 1.25% effective rate)
  • $183 homeowners insurance

The actual number for any specific property depends on sale price, HOA if applicable, and lender.
